6.      etc       based on the expected value length     Command Level Errors    If an error occurs  an error reply is returned to the host in place of the normal reply     ERROR  UNABLE TO CONNECT    These Command Level Errors are indicated below  literal ASCII string  prefaced with a        DESCRIPTION    The monitor cannot respond        NO OPEN DELIMITER    The monitor could not find the character   lt    open delimiter  in the  message received  making the message not interpretable  syntax  error         NO CLOSE DELIMITER    The monitor could not find the character     gt      close delimiter  in the  message received  making the message not interpretable  syntax  error         NO LINE FEED    The monitor could not find the linefeed character in the message  received  making the message not interpretable  syntax error         INVALID CRC CHAR    The monitor detected a non hexadecimal CRC character  syntax  error         UNDEFINED ERROR    The monitor detected an undefinable syntax error        RESPONSE TOO LARGE    In a multiple command message  the response is greater than the  maximum size response buffer   Separate the multiple command  message into two or more messages            REQUEST CORRUPT The monitor detected an invalid CRC   CHANNEL OUT OF The central monitor could not reply because the channel number  RANGE requested is invalid        BAD MSG HEADER    The message header did not contain    DIAP    as the first four  characters       COMMAND TO LARGE    The mes

18. nection Type  The DIAP is a point to point  hierarchical  one or more into one host  protocol  All  communications are initiated by the host  No common access media types  including serial    multi point connections  are supported   lt is    request reply  non continuous protocol  Only numeric data  no waveforms            supported     Physical Protocol  The physical interface for the DIAP is asynchronous serial  with a baud rate of 9600 and  19200  8 bits  1 stop bit  no parity     Session Protocol    The messages must be are encapsulated as follows     First Character Last Character    Command    HEADER Reply                Error       DIAP Communication Protocol Service Manual 0070 10 0307    Datascope Improved ASCII Protocol  DIAP     1 2 4    Datascope Improved ASCII Protocol    All Commands are case insensitive ASCII    All Replies are mixed case as indicated in next section   Timeout  No reply for 10 seconds    Maximum message size for Commands is 255 total bytes     Maximum message size for Replies is 511 bytes              Where   ITEM DESCRIPTION TYPE LENGTH  HEADER DIAPxxx literal ASCII character 443  where         is    channel number from 000           decimal numeric  to 999    it is always 000 for a patient monitor    it is always 001 to 999 for a central  monitor   lt   gt  are delimiter characters literal ASCII string 1 1  CRC is a cyclical redundancy check as ASCII hex numeric 4  described in the section beginning on page  2 1   LF is an ASCII line feed cha

20. racter  literal ASCII character 1       Command Reply Legend    This is the legend to the Command Reply list  It indicates how the arguments for the    Commands and Replies are defined  See    Commands and Replies    on page 1 6     Items designated as    ASCII decimal numeric    are padded with leading  left  zeros   Items designated as    ASCII hex numeric    are padded with leading  lef  zeros    Items designated as    literal ASCII string    are padded with trailing  right  spaces    Items designated as    ASCII string    are padded with trailing  right  spaces    Items designated as    ASCII string    will be truncated by the monitor central as necessary     Items designated as    ASCII string    may contain A Z  a z  0 9  comma  period  dash   space  question mark           ITEM DESCRIPTION TYPE LENGTH UNITS  XXX generic ASCII number ASCII decimal 3  numeric  5 numeric sign ASCII        1  productName Accutorr   Passport   literal ASCII string 32    Passport ST   VISA    Passport 2   Spectrum      Spectrum OR  Trio                      mVersion monitor software version ASCII string  mRevision monitor software revision ASCII decimal  numeric  pVersion protocol format ASCII decimal  version 000 numeric  pRevision protocol software revision ASCII decimal  numeric  patRoom1 patient room  line 1 ASCII string  0070 10 0307 DIAP Communication Protocol Service Manual    Datascope Improved ASCII Protocol    Datascope Improved ASCII Protocol
